Understanding Halal Cuisine

With its roots in Islamic dietary laws, halal cuisine refers to food that is permissible to consume according to these guidelines. This includes ensuring that all ingredients are sourced from halal-certified suppliers and that meat is slaughtered in a manner consistent with Islamic principles. Thus, when it comes to Halal Hotpot, diners can expect an array of ingredients that meet these specific standards, from fresh meats to a variety of vegetables, all prepared to create a delectable feast.

Q: What is halal hotpot, and how does it differ from regular hotpot?

Halal hotpot is a variation of traditional hotpot that adheres to Islamic dietary laws, ensuring all ingredients, including meat, broth, and condiments, are halal-certified. Unlike regular hotpots, which may include non-halal options, Halal Hotpot offers a completely inclusive dining experience for those seeking halal meals, making it suitable for Muslim patrons and anyone who prefers halal food.

Q: What types of broth are typically offered in Halal hotpot establishments?

Halal hotpot restaurants often provide a diverse selection of broth flavours to suit various tastes. Common options include spicy Sichuan broth, herbal tom yum, and a clear chicken or beef broth. Some restaurants even offer a dual-pot option, allowing diners to enjoy two different flavours in one meal, catering to both adventurous and traditional palates.
